the Fe in (Fe(H2O)5NO) SO4 has how 3 unpaired electrons !

why ...!?

The oxidation state of Fe in [Fe(H2O)5NO]SO4 is +1. Therefore

26Fe+1 = 1s2 2s2 2p6 3s2 3p6 4s1 3d6

When the weak field ligand H2O and strong field ligand NO attack the configuration changes as follows:

26Fe+1 = 1s2 2s2 2p6 3s2 3p6 3d7 4s° 4p° 4d°

The number of unpaired electron in 3d sub-shell is 3.
